About this route:
A direct, nonstop flight between Williams Lake Airport (YWL), Williams Lake, British Columbia, Canada and Wallops Flight Facility Airport (WAL), Wallops Island, Virginia, United States would travel a Great Circle distance of 2,426 miles (or 3,904 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the relatively short distance between Williams Lake Airport and Wallops Flight Facility Airport, the route shown on this map most likely still appears to be a straight line.

Facts about Wallops Flight Facility Airport (WAL):
- The WFF mobile range assets have been used to support rocket launches from locations in the Arctic and Antarctic regions, South America, Africa, Europe, Australia, and at sea.
- The closest airport to Wallops Flight Facility Airport (WAL) is Accomack County Airport (MFV), which is located 26 miles (42 kilometers) SW of WAL.
- LCT2 is an effort to produce a relatively low-cost transceiver to allow launch vehicles to communicate through NASA's Tracking and Data Relay Satellite System after they have gone over the horizon from the launch site.
- The furthest airport from Wallops Flight Facility Airport (WAL) is Margaret River Airport (MGV), which is located 11,785 miles (18,965 kilometers) away in Margaret River, Western Australia, Australia.
- The Wallops Visitor Center has a variety of hands-on exhibits and hosts weekly educational activities and programs to enable children to explore and learn about the technologies designed and used by NASA researchers and scientists.
- Because of Wallops Flight Facility Airport's relatively low elevation of 0 feet, planes can take off or land at Wallops Flight Facility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
- Major Wallops facilities include FAA-certified runways.
- The Wallops mobile range instrumentation includes telemetry, radar, command and power systems.
